Which example below is not a random assignment to experimental groups?


A) assign numbers to subjects, put corresponding numbers in a hat and pull out numbers, place the first subject in the experimental group and the second subject in the control group, and continue until all numbers are used
B) ask subjects whether they prefer to be in the experimental group or the control group, and then assign subjects based on their preference
C) flip a coin, assigning subjects getting a head to the control group and those getting a tail to the experimental group
D) use a random number generator after assigning numbers to your subjects
